Software Engineer – Autonomy Software, Junior

AM Pierce and AssociatesCalifornia, MD
$75,000 - $95,000Onsite

About The Position

We are looking for a candidate who will be performing the role of a Software Engineer - Junior, focusing on autonomy software porting and integration. The successful candidate will work closely with senior engineers and subject matter experts to port autonomy software from one baseline to another, ensuring the functionality and performance of the software remain consistent. This role is an excellent opportunity for recent graduates or early-career software engineers to gain experience in cutting-edge autonomy systems and software engineering practices.

Requirements

  • Bachelor's Degree in Computer Science, Software Engineering, or a related field.
  • Basic understanding of programming languages such as C++, Python, or Java.
  • Experience with software version control systems (e.g., Git) and development environments (e.g., Visual Studio, Eclipse).
  • Strong problem-solving skills and a desire to learn about software porting and autonomy systems.
  • Familiarity with software testing methodologies and debugging tools is a plus.
  • Good communication skills and ability to work collaboratively in a team environment.

Nice To Haves

  • Experience with robotics, unmanned systems, or autonomy software development.
  • Knowledge of software development best practices, including Agile methodologies.
  • Exposure to real-time operating systems (RTOS) or embedded systems.

Responsibilities

  • Assist in porting autonomy software components from one software baseline to another, ensuring compatibility and performance.
  • Work with senior engineers to identify and resolve software issues that arise during the porting process.
  • Collaborate with cross-functional teams, including hardware engineers, system engineers, and data scientists, to support integration and testing efforts.
  • Participate in code reviews, documentation, and testing to ensure high-quality software delivery.
  • Utilize version control systems and continuous integration tools to manage code changes and ensure smooth deployment.

Benefits

  • Medical, Dental and Vision Insurance
  • Life and Accidental Death & Disability Coverage
  • Traditional 401(k) and ROTH 401k Retirement Plans
  • Discretionary Profit-Sharing Program
  • Paid Time Off and Holidays
  • Professional Development Opportunities
  • Incentive Programs, Awards and Recognition
  • Employee Assistance Program
  • Will Preparation
  • Identity Theft Protection & Legal Support
  • Referral Program
  • Voluntary Accident, Critical Illness, and Hospital Indemnity Coverage
  • Pet Insurance
  • Norton Life Lock
  • HSA and FSA plans
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service